Raymond L. Pearl of Natick passed away on Sunday, July 20, 2014 at the UMASS Medical Center in Worcester. He was seventy-eight years of age.
Born in Framingham, Massachusetts on December 24, 1935, he graduated from St. Mary’s high school of Milford in 1953.
Mr. Pearl worked as a truck driver for over fifty years, beginning with Anchor Motor Freight of Boston and finally driving for construction companies in the local area, retiring in 2011.
He was a resident of Natick and a member of St. Linus Church for forty-three years. Mr. Pearl served as an elected town meeting member in Natick and was a member of the Fraternal Order of Eagles in Framingham.
He enjoyed working in his yard and garden, traveling to the Cape, Maine and Vermont with his wife Janet and was an animal lover, especially cats.
Ray was the devoted husband of the late Janet F. (Carmichael) Pearl and together they shared forty-five years of marriage.
